Visiting contractors to the newly opened fifth floor of the Larkspun Building must check in at the second-floor reception before proceeding. Escorts are required beyond the lift lobby, and hard hats remain mandatory in the east wing. To reach the contractor staging area, enter the code provided below at the stairwell door.

turnstile pass: bdg-TXR-4

## Provenance: Undo/Redo in Sketchloom

Welcome aboard! The undo/redo stack in Sketchloom is snapshot-based, and every snapshot format change gets a migration baked into the release. That means knowing *exactly* which build you're on matters when debugging weird redo behavior. The build pipeline stamps each artifact automatically, and the stamp for the current mainline artifact appears just below.

session token of kageg-tahop = htk14_af3c1ccccb7dcf

## Releases

Hey support folks — quick notes on ProfileMesh shard releases. Each release re-balances user-profile shards gradually, so don't panic if a lookup lands on a stale shard for a few minutes post-deploy; it self-heals. Release bundles are published twice a month and are always signed. If a customer asks you to verify a bundle they downloaded, walk them through the checksum step using the public signing key below.

deploy key for kawif-bageg: bky19_YQNdHDgpaLxUNwPoHm9